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 large apples (Granny Smith or Braeburn)
  • 2 cups (250g) all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up (200g) gran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up (120ml) v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up (120ml) buttermilk
  • 1/2 cup (60g) all-purpose flour (for streusel)
  • 1/3 cup (70g) granulated sugar (for streusel)
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on (for streusel)
  • 1/4 cup (60g) cold unsalted butter (for streusel)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9-inch round cake pan.
  2. Peel, core, and slice the apples, then set them aside.
  3.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
  4. In another bowl, beat the eggs, vegetable oil, vanilla extract, and buttermilk until well combined.
  5.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ients, mixing until just combined.
  6. Fold in the sliced apples gently.
  7.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an and smooth the top.
  8. To make the streusel topping, combine the flour, sugar, and cinnamon in a bowl, then cut in the cold butter until crumbly.
  9. Sprinkle the streusel over the apple cake batter.
  10.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  11.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

You can substitute the all-purpose flour with whole wheat pastry flour for a nuttier flavor. Adjust cinnamon according to your taste preference.
